What does "Paragon" mean, anyway?

The word "Paragon" is linked to "touchstone," a standard for testing quality. A "paragon" is a model or pattern of perfection. Paragon Air Adventures creates the model of outstanding aviation experiences, then strives to provide for your continuing adventure.
